Pakistan makes a special request to Kuwait

KUWAIT : Foreign Minister Shah Mehmood Qureshi makes a special request toKuwaiti authorities.

He has urged the Kuwaiti authorities to soften its visa policy forPakistani community.

He highlighted the issue during a meeting with Kuwaiti Interior MinisterKhaled Al Jarrah Al Sabah in Kuwait.

They discussed Pak-Kuwait bilateral relations and issue of visarestrictions. Shah Mehmood Qureshi said Pakistani workforce comprising overone hundred thousand individuals is playing an important role indevelopment of Kuwait.

He said the members of Pakistani community living in Kuwait for last manyyears are confused about the visa restrictions and are finding it hard toinvite their families to the country. The number of Pakistanis was 115,000in 2015 which has now reduced to 105,000 due to this reason.

Foreign Minister urged the Kuwaiti Interior Minister to review the visapolicy for Pakistanis and exempt Pakistan from visa restrictions in placesince 2011.

Khaled Al Jarrah Al Sabah assured the Foreign Minister that government ofKuwait will sympathetically look into the issue and will take serious stepsto resolve it.
